SQLite 是一种轻量级的数据库,因其体积小、跨平台、易于使用等特点,在移动应用、嵌入式系统以及个人项目中广泛应用。为了确保数据安全,备份与恢复是数据库管理的重要环节。本文将为您盘点几款SQLite...
SQLite 是一种轻量级的数据库,因其体积小、跨平台、易于使用等特点,在移动应用、嵌入式系统以及个人项目中广泛应用。为了确保数据安全,备份与恢复是数据库管理的重要环节。本文将为您盘点几款SQLite数据库管理的利器,帮助您轻松实现数据的备份与恢复。
SQLiteManager 是一款功能强大的SQLite数据库管理工具,支持Windows、MacOS和Linux平台。它具有以下特点:
DB Browser for SQLite 是一款免费、开源的SQLite数据库管理工具,支持Windows、MacOS和Linux平台。它具有以下特点:
DBeaver 是一款跨平台的开源数据库管理工具,支持多种数据库,包括SQLite。它具有以下特点:
对于Linux用户,可以使用crontab实现SQLite数据库的自动化备份。以下是一个示例:
# 编辑crontab文件
crontab -e
# 添加以下行,每天凌晨1点备份数据库
0 1 * * * /path/to/your/script.sh其中,/path/to/your/script.sh 是用于备份SQLite数据库的脚本,具体内容如下:
# 备份SQLite数据库
backup_path="/path/to/your/backup"
db_path="/path/to/your/database.db"
# 创建备份目录
mkdir -p "$backup_path"
# 备份数据库
cp "$db_path" "$backup_path/database_$(date +%Y%m%d%H%M%S).db"对于Windows用户,可以使用Windows Task Scheduler实现SQLite数据库的自动化备份。以下是一个示例:
/path/to/your/database.db,即要备份的数据库文件路径。以上介绍了几款SQLite数据库管理利器,以及自动化备份与恢复的方法。希望这些工具和技巧能帮助您轻松实现SQLite数据库的备份与恢复,确保数据安全。